    Lease Controller (Lease In) - Johannesburg

    Main purpose / objective of the position:

    • To manage and control all contracts and effectively manage the portfolio on a regional basis, the objective being the reduction of rental expenditure. Take responsibility for data integrity (building and tenant). Handle audit queries. To control all aspects of Leases, i.e., Accounts and Financial. To oversee the financial processes and reporting to clients. To establish and maintain effective support services for the property management functions of the portfolio.

    Operational Deliverables:
    Will include, but not limited to:

    • Manage leasing and lease renewals, rent reviews, negotiations and documentation relating to obtaining approvals and acceptance of leases, facilitating the signing of lease agreements (from a Landlord and Tenant perspective).
    • Oversee and verify the capturing of all new lease agreements, lease renewals, and lease corrections on SAP.
    • Assist accounting services, (Credit control), by arranging payment of rentals, adjustments, reconciliations, variance reporting and vendor creation.
    • Compile deviation reports and communicate. Implement preventative steps to prevent recurring.
    • Keep, maintain and update detailed monthly status updates of own building and lease classifications.
    • Compile property related reporting schedules. Actively managing expiry profile of portfolio.
    • Actively maintain a reminder system to ensure finalisation of all matters pertaining to lease administration.
    • Oversee landlord management and administration, i.e., retention and alignment of profile by meeting with landlords and responding to their needs.
    • Assist and interact with Business Units and Third Parties in respect of additional space requirements and maintenance requirements.
    • Ensure resolution of queries within specified SLA requirements. Pro-actively manage and deliver on solutions.

    Decision making authority:

    • Works within the broad framework of existing policies and guidelines, as amended from time to time. Required to work strictly within prescribed rules, routines & standards.

    Experience / Education / Knowledge:

    • Grade 12 or relevant qualification equal to NQF level 4.
    • Additional Property related qualification of any NQF 5 or higher.
    • A bachelor’s degree in finance, Property Management, Business or Accounting will be an advantage.
    • At least 5 years relevant experience in Property Management/Administration, i.e., leasing administration, financial accounting and negotiation/communication skills, directly interfacing with clients and providing general administrative support services.
    • Knowledge of South Africa’s property industry, property markets and general administration/Accounting/Finance acumen.
    • Knowledge of Asset Management and knowledge of the legal requirements of the essentials of a lease agreement.
    • ERP Systems and Procedures, general business and property management acumen, house rules, service contractors, insurance policies and procedures.
